Abstract

The impact of resonant scattering of polarized X-rays is illustrated taking the gadolinium4dedge energy range as an example. It is shown that: (i) the study of the reflection of linearly polarized light by a magnetized Gd sample gives information on the electronic states of the system, similar to that given by magnetic circular dichroism in absorption; (ii) the energy-loss peaks corresponding to spin-flip transitions in the4d → 4fexcitation exhibit a strong circular dichroism.
